IYH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

484 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ares US Healthcare ETF (IYH)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$1.68B — up 2% from $1.65B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 49 funds opened new IYH posit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 12 holders — while 145 added to existing stakes and 157 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Manulife (Manufacturers Life Insurance), opening a new position worth an estimated $120M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$188M.
